release-plz now creates draft PRs (pr_draft = true). When a user marks the PR ready for review, that user action triggers the normal CI workflow—no manual commit-status plumbing or PAT needed. ci.yml gains the ready_for_review event type so the Test workspace check fires on the transition from draft to ready.
